    In this clip, Craig Hodges spoke about being blackballed after he handed a letter to George H.W. Bush related to the struggle of the Black person in America. He noted that he was dropped from the Bulls after the incident and did not receive any calls from any team afterward, despite winning three NBA championships. Vlad and Hodges then discussed if that was a form of retaliation for his actions. Watch above.
